Cut goat cheese log into 8 equal pieces; roll into balls, if desired. Pour olive oil into clean wide-necked jars until halfway full. Distribute chili flakes, fennel seed, and peppercorns equally into both jars. Add the goat cheese pieces one at a time, adding a little olive oil between each one so they are fully immersed. …Goat Goodness Cheeseboard. Goat Rodeo Farm & Dairy is a 130 acre family owned farm located near Pittsburgh Pa in northern Allegheny County. We have a herd of more than 100 alpine and nubian dairy goats and bring in cow’s milk from le-ara farms to make a variety of fresh and aged cheeses using traditional techniques for artisan cheese production.

Feta originated in Greece and is made with either sheep milk or a combination of sheep and goat milk that is curdled, then cured in brine for four to six weeks. The best option is for the breastfeeding mother to avoid consuming ...Wendell is a goat cheesemaker. He and his wife Rhonda run a five-acre Grade A farmstead dairy on the outskirts of Phoenix in Buckeye. The farm is home to 300 Anglo-Nubian goats that produce enough artisan cheese to service 110 restaurants and a handful of retail outlets, including dozens of farmers' markets, around Arizona. Goat cheese clocks in at just 75 calories per ounce—significantly less than popular cow cheeses like mozzarella (85), brie … mixology classes nyc Chèvre Just Means 'Goat' In America, fresh goat cheese has come to be called "chèvre," which just means "goat" in English. So the term doesn't describe a specific kind of cheese but rather a whole class of cheeses, all made from goat's milk.
